Transaction 41c795aec5e02683842c449ff4753290018233b656ccf04f3c061f78528ce79d

2 Input
2 Outputs
  • 41c795aec5e02683842c449ff4753290018233b656ccf04f3c061f78528ce79d:0
  • value  156433749
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 41c795aec5e02683842c449ff4753290018233b656ccf04f3c061f78528ce79d:1
  • value  1600244
    address  3GCnGG47mRJNN24fWKVTJnMn9CR47QyrCX